Cisco Secure Firewall ASA and FTD 0-Day Vulnerability Exploitation
CVE-2026-20349 is a critical zero-day vulnerability (CVSS 8.6) affecting Cisco Secure Firewall Adaptive Security Appliance (ASA) and Secure Firewall Threat Defense (FTD) software. The flaw originates from insufficient error checking during the processing of malformed HTTP requests, allowing unauthenticated remote attackers to trigger a complete system crash. This results in a Denial of Service (DoS) state, causing the immediate collapse of VPN connectivity and total disruption of firewall-mediated network traffic. Immediate remediation via vendor security patches is required to prevent perimeter security failure and restore operational availability.
